TURN-208: Gatevale turnstile counters at the Merrow Field pilot double-count when a rotation reverses mid-cycle. Attendance totals drift roughly 2% high per event. The debounce window fix is implemented, reviewed by Ilsa, and soak-tested across two simulated match days without drift. Ready for your cut; the candidate build is identified below.

trace token, tagag-tafog: htk6_5ed18c

# Incremental Static Rebuilds — Contacts

The Spriggan site builder does incremental rebuilds keyed on content hashes. Full rebuilds trigger only when the template layer changes. Broken dependency graphs (stale pages after an edit): file under the `spriggan-graph` component. Build queue stalls: page web-infra on-call. Template cache questions go to the Harkwell publishing pod. Do not force full rebuilds in production without approval. For approvals or anything unclear, email the build systems group.

alerts address for bafog-tawep: ulavan_sorwyn_fraax@kelviworks.local

### Checklist: Recipe-scaling calculator — Skillet Forge

Confirm fractional scaling rounds correctly for yields under 0.5x; prior releases dropped sub-teaspoon quantities. Run the golden-recipe suite against the Pannier dataset and diff outputs. Unit conversions must stay locked to the v3 table. Do not ship if any metric/imperial pair diverges beyond tolerance. Once the suite passes, note the release build token below for traceability.

pipeline stamp: htk3_69f

From a security standpoint, note that fallback behavior routes queries to the secondary resolver tier without re-validating response signatures, which is the main review concern. Mitigation caps TTL variance and staggers expiry. No evidence of spoofed responses has been found to date, but the audit remains open. The full packet captures and resolver configuration history are archived on the internal page below.

dashboard of tawef-yageg = https://jira.torvaworks.corp/deploy/merge_requests/board/settings/issue/settings/build/86c86b97dff3e2041bd6f497